The Row: Core Brand Identity and 2025 Positioning
Brand evolution and market presence
The Row remains the central creative vehicle for Mary-Kate and Ashley Olsen in 2025. Known for meticulous craftsmanship, architectural silhouettes, and elevated neutral palettes, the brand maintains a strong presence in high-end retail and among style insiders. Distribution through select boutiques and partnerships ensures exclusivity, while consistent critical acclaim reinforces their reputation as leaders in luxury fashion. The Olsens’ influence here is direct and ongoing, unlike sporadic external collaborations.
